Famitsu, Japan’s leading video game publication known for its influential reviews and industry insights, has published its latest batch of review scores for games released in the week of July 2, 2025.
This week’s lineup features high-profile titles making waves on the Nintendo Switch, including "Death Stranding 2: On the Beach," "Cult Vs Gal," and "Police Simulator: Patrol Officers." These scores are eagerly anticipated by industry professionals and gamers alike, as Famitsu's rigorous four-reviewer scoring system sets the tone for critical reception across Japan and often influences sales performance on platforms such as the Nintendo eShop.
"Death Stranding 2: On the Beach," developed by Kojima Productions, stands out as the week’s most acclaimed title.
Receiving near-perfect marks, Famitsu’s panel of four reviewers awarded the game individual scores of 10, 9, 10, and 10.
This remarkable result solidifies the action-adventure sequel’s status as a top-tier release, echoing the critical success of the original "Death Stranding," which garnered notable industry awards and commercial achievements for the studio.
Reviewers praised the game’s compelling narrative and innovative gameplay mechanics, underscoring the creative vision brought by Hideo Kojima and his team.
Meanwhile, "Cult Vs Gal" demonstrated strong performance with scores of 8, 8, 8, and 7.
This indie title, available on the Nintendo Switch eShop, has been commended for its unique premise and engaging gameplay loop, resonating with fans seeking fresh experiences beyond mainstream releases.
"Police Simulator: Patrol Officers" also made an appearance in this week’s review roundup.
The simulation game received ratings of 8, 7, 7, and 6, indicating a positive yet mixed response from Famitsu’s editors.
While the game was recognized for its realistic portrayal of police work and operational depth, reviewers noted areas where gameplay polish could be improved.
